# Build Provenance: GraphTrellis

Quick version for on-call: every GraphTrellis dependency-graph visualizer release is cut by the Mortlake pipeline, never by hand. If someone asks "is this binary legit?", check it against the provenance log before saying yes — we've been burned by stale artifacts before. The current verified release is identified by the token just below.

session token of bajog-tadup = htk3_ffc

# FormulaCage — Environments

FormulaCage sandboxes user-supplied spreadsheet formulas for the Bramblewick suite. Three environments: dev (sandbox limits relaxed, tracing on), staging (prod-identical limits, synthetic tenant data), prod (strict limits, no shell escape hatches, ever). New hires: never copy prod limits into dev manually; pull them from the manifest. Staging is the only place to test limit changes. The current production configuration values are listed below.

deployment values, tafof-taduf:
pelius:
  pin: 6508
  tenant: praiel
  seal: seal_4e33a2f4
  metrics_host: metrics.pelius.plorvagrid.corp
  standby_team: druix
  escalation: juldor-norius
  nonce: 5db598

### RestockPilot: Release Prerequisites

Before cutting a release, confirm that the RestockPilot planner can reach the SnackGrid inventory service, since the build pipeline runs an integration smoke test against staging during packaging. A failed handshake here blocks the release tag, so verify credentials first. The pipeline reads its staging credential from the deploy config; for reference and manual verification, the current key appears below.

service key, tajof-fawip: vxb4-JNOz